A Welsh Vision: The Evocative Landscapes of Melanie Wotton
Melanie Wotton, born in Wales in 1962, is an artist deeply rooted in the dramatic beauty and subtle energies of her homeland. While biographical details remain somewhat private, focusing instead on the work itself, it’s clear that Wotton's artistic journey is inextricably linked to the Welsh landscape – a source of constant inspiration and emotional resonance. Her paintings aren’t merely depictions of places; they are explorations of feeling, memory, and the ephemeral qualities of light and atmosphere. Wotton’s work has garnered attention for its unique blend of Impressionistic sensibilities with a contemporary abstract edge, creating pieces that feel both grounded in tradition and strikingly modern. She currently resides in Swansea and is an active member of the elysium gallery community.Early Influences & Artistic Development
The influence of Romanticism is palpable in Wotton’s work, particularly in her early explorations of landscape. She acknowledges Claude Monet as a significant inspiration, not necessarily for replicating his style but for his dedication to capturing fleeting moments of light and color. However, Wotton quickly moved beyond direct imitation, developing a distinctive voice characterized by flowing forms, expressive brushwork, and a vibrant palette. Her initial training wasn’t formally documented, suggesting a self-directed path fueled by observation and experimentation. This independent approach allowed her to cultivate a deeply personal style that prioritizes emotional response over strict representational accuracy. The landscapes she paints are not static scenes but rather dynamic impressions – fragments of memory filtered through the lens of feeling.Themes & Symbolism in Wotton’s Art
Wotton's paintings often center around Welsh valleys, hillsides, and coastal regions, yet they transcend simple topographical representation. There is a strong symbolic element present in her work, with recurring motifs suggesting deeper meanings related to nature, time, and the human condition. The artist herself describes responding to “fugitive incidents of light” – those fleeting moments that transform ordinary objects and spaces into something extraordinary. This pursuit of ephemeral beauty leads to compositions that are as much abstract depictions of color and movement as they are recordings of specific places. Cynefin, a Welsh word roughly translating to ‘place’ or ‘habitat’, embodies this core theme, representing not just a physical location but also a sense of belonging and emotional connection to the land. Her paintings frequently evoke a feeling of serenity and contemplation, inviting viewers to connect with their own memories and experiences of nature.A Multifaceted Approach: Painting & Curatorial Work
Beyond her painting practice, Melanie Wotton has dedicated herself to fostering artistic communities as an Exhibitions Curator and Arts in Health Project Manager for Cardiff and Vale University Health Board. This dual role highlights a commitment to the transformative power of art – both in personal expression and in promoting wellbeing within the community. Her curatorial work demonstrates a keen eye for talent and a dedication to showcasing diverse perspectives, while her projects within healthcare settings underscore the therapeutic benefits of creative engagement. This holistic approach—embracing both artistic creation and its broader social impact—is central to Wotton’s philosophy.
